From mboxrd@z Thu Jan 1 00:00:00 1970 Return-path: Received: from dude02.hi.pengutronix.de ([2001:67c:670:100:1d::28] helo=dude02.pengutronix.de.) by metis.ext.pengutronix.de with esmtp (Exim 4.92) (envelope-from ) id 1iuyjO-00037a-LO for ptxdist@pengutronix.de; Fri, 24 Jan 2020 14:10:38 +0100 From: Philipp Zabel Date: Fri, 24 Jan 2020 14:10:38 +0100 Message-Id: <20200124131038.24174-1-p.zabel@pengutronix.de> MIME-Version: 1.0 Subject: [ptxdist] [PATCH] libva: version bump 2.5.0 -> 2.6.1 List-Id: PTXdist Development Mailing List List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Reply-To: ptxdist@pengutronix.de Content-Type: text/plain; charset="us-ascii" Content-Transfer-Encoding: 7bit Errors-To: ptxdist-bounces@pengutronix.de Sender: "ptxdist" To: ptxdist@pengutronix.de - Build using Meson. Signed-off-by: Philipp Zabel --- rules/libva.in | 1 + rules/libva.make | 23 +++++++++++------------ 2 files changed, 12 insertions(+), 12 deletions(-) diff --git a/rules/libva.in b/rules/libva.in index 5d074a5cc865..8dd2229030fe 100644 --- a/rules/libva.in +++ b/rules/libva.in @@ -2,6 +2,7 @@ menuconfig LIBVA tristate + select HOST_MESON select LIBDRM select XORG_LIB_X11 if LIBVA_X11 || LIBVA_GLX select XORG_LIB_XEXT if LIBVA_X11 diff --git a/rules/libva.make b/rules/libva.make index c0f8a8ae6a37..9033c0e115b5 100644 --- a/rules/libva.make +++ b/rules/libva.make @@ -14,8 +14,8 @@ PACKAGES-$(PTXCONF_LIBVA) += libva # # Paths and names # -LIBVA_VERSION := 2.5.0 -LIBVA_MD5 := 3688212fb7a87947070f3729e91ff7cf +LIBVA_VERSION := 2.6.1 +LIBVA_MD5 := aef13eb48e01a47d1416d97462a22a11 LIBVA := libva-$(LIBVA_VERSION) LIBVA_SUFFIX := tar.bz2 LIBVA_URL := https://github.com/intel/libva/releases/download/$(LIBVA_VERSION)/$(LIBVA).$(LIBVA_SUFFIX) @@ -32,17 +32,16 @@ LIBVA_ENABLE-$(PTXCONF_LIBVA_X11) += x11 LIBVA_ENABLE-$(PTXCONF_LIBVA_GLX) += glx LIBVA_ENABLE-$(PTXCONF_LIBVA_WAYLAND) += wayland -# -# autoconf -# -LIBVA_CONF_TOOL := autoconf +LIBVA_CONF_TOOL := meson LIBVA_CONF_OPT := \ - $(CROSS_AUTOCONF_USR) \ - --disable-docs \ - $(addprefix --enable-,$(LIBVA_ENABLE-y)) \ - $(addprefix --disable-,$(LIBVA_ENABLE-)) \ - --enable-va-messaging \ - $(GLOBAL_LARGE_FILE_OPTION) + $(CROSS_MESON_USR) \ + -Ddisable_drm=false \ + -Ddriverdir='' \ + -Denable_docs=false \ + -Denable_va_messaging=true \ + -Dwith_glx=$(call ptx/yesno, PTXCONF_LIBVA_GLX) \ + -Dwith_wayland=$(call ptx/yesno, PTXCONF_LIBVA_WAYLAND) \ + -Dwith_x11=$(call ptx/yesno, PTXCONF_LIBVA_X11) # ---------------------------------------------------------------------------- # Target-Install -- 2.20.1 _______________________________________________ ptxdist mailing list ptxdist@pengutronix.de